Abstract

Comparison of dynamic changes of biochemical reactions in the liver and CNS of freshwater liver mollusc LYMNAEA STAGNALIS has been conducted. It has been conducted during incubation in the highly concentrated solution of glucose. The indicators of superoxiddismutase (SOD) activity, the level of renewed glutation (G-SH), Se-dependant glutation peroxidase (Se-GP) and TBA-active products were estimated and compared. Also for the tissues of the Central Neural System and tissues samples of liver it was found out by glucoseoxidate method the concentration of glucose in haemolymph of the investigated biological object in the conditions of hyperglycemia. A comparative estimation of the general protein concentration in both tissues was conducted. Resistance of the liver tissue to hyperglycemia and a reverse effect towards CNS was found out.
